About Carpenter Careers in Oklahoma

Carpenters construct, install, and repair building frameworks and structures made from wood and other materials. They work on a wide variety of projects, from building homes and commercial structures to installing cabinets and framing walls. Carpentry is one of the oldest and most versatile building trades, requiring both precision craftsmanship and practical problem-solving skills.

In Oklahoma, carpenters earn an average of $50,102 per year as of 2026, with salaries ranging from $32,658 for entry-level roles to $75,176 for the most experienced professionals — +13.9% below the national average. Pay is influenced most by specialization (finish carpentry, framing, cabinetry), union membership and collective bargaining agreements, and the specific metro area within Oklahoma.

After adjusting for Oklahoma's cost of living (below average), a Carpenter's salary of $50,102 has the purchasing power of $57,589 in an average-cost area.

What is the average Carpenter salary in Oklahoma?

The average Carpenter salary in Oklahoma is $50,102 per year ($24.09/hour) based on 2026 data across 1 metro areas. This is 13.9% below the national average of $58,210.

What is the highest paying city for Carpenters in Oklahoma?

Oklahoma City, OK is the highest paying city for Carpenters in Oklahoma, with a median salary of $50,102 per year.

What is the salary range for Carpenters in Oklahoma?

Carpenter salaries in Oklahoma range from $32,658 (entry-level, 10th percentile) to $75,176 (experienced, 90th percentile). The median salary is $50,102 per year.
